Breathing 101 (August 7, 9 and 10 @ 1 PM) 4 hours $60

Materials: Information packet, Breath Builder ($15), Conable: The Structures

and Movement of Breathing ($8).

This class will cover Body Mapping of the breathing apparatus to gain awareness of movement during breathing as well as develop breathing skills for performance, greater focus and relaxation…good for the performer and non-performer alike! Learn the essentials of a three-part breath as well as the use and function of our 3 diaphragms. Exercises on the Breath Builder show how one can develop better breath control. Multiple exercises are presented to teach the participant how to free the breath.

Reed-Making 101: Wrapping a Reed (August 11 @ 2 PM) 1.5 hours $23

Materials: thread, staple, cane, bees wax, mandrel, ruler and an inquiring mind!

Reed-making is an essential skill of an oboist. A discussion of store bought reeds versus hand made reeds will help the participant gain a deeper understanding reed functions. Then, a demonstration of how to tie an oboe reed will help the student learn the skills to begin how to do it themselves. This preliminary class is ideal for the inexperienced student to gain some hands-on experience. Rhythmic Studies (August 9 and 11 @ 2:30 PM, June 23 @ 1 PM) 3 hours $45

Materials: Bona: Rhythmical Studies , metronome.

Participants will learn how to use a metronome, how to count with accuracy through the use of subdivisions, demonstrate conducting patters and ultimately demonstrate three separate rhythms at once!
